Abstract in English
The work aims to make benefit from existence
multi-CPU and multi-GPU, exploiting the calculation processes
which do multi-GPU, which aims to form mechanism to
scheduling a directed acyclic graph(DAG), it aims to reduce
communication between resources and inter linked task
scheduling in the best form.
